Rural Transit Expansion in Boise
Idaho's rural transit infrastructure has significant gaps, particularly in the areas surrounding Boise, the state's capital. Although Boise itself is growing rapidly, with over 240,000 residents, many rural communities face transportation barriers that inhibit access to essential services and economic opportunities. Approximately 13% of residents in nearby rural areas lack reliable transportation options, creating substantial challenges for low-income families and individuals with mobility limitations.
Residents in these outlying areas often find themselves isolated due to inadequate public transit options. Rural communities, which comprise a significant portion of Idaho's geography, frequently lack the infrastructure necessary to support comprehensive transit services. The barriers faced by these populations include long travel distances to urban centers, limited bus schedules, and no access to rideshare services. For many, the absence of reliable transportation options results in missed job opportunities, inaccessibility to healthcare services, and social isolation.
The federal grant program aims to enhance rural transit services in Idaho, with a focus on improving connectivity for underserved populations surrounding Boise. By expanding the public transit network, the program seeks to provide affordable and reliable transportation solutions that can serve both social and economic needs. This includes the implementation of on-demand shuttle services, strategic partnerships with local organizations for outreach, and improved scheduling to meet community needs.
Furthermore, these transit enhancements will address critical gaps in the current system by integrating technology for more efficient ride coordination and scheduling. This approach is particularly relevant in urban-rural contexts, where flexibility is vital to accommodate the varied transit needs of individuals. Increased public transit access can enhance mobility, improve access to job training and educational programs, and provide a lifeline for those dependent on public transportation.
To gauge the effectiveness of this transit expansion program, the expected outcomes will include increased ridership, enhanced service reliability, and improved community engagement. This targeted investment in transit infrastructure is essential for fostering equitable access to jobs, education, and healthcare in Idaho's rural regions, leading to broader economic development and improved quality of life.
